Furthermore, changes in the environment also affect its density. As the temperature increases, the thermal motion of butyl acetate molecules intensifies, and the molecular spacing may change, causing its volume to expand slightly, while the mass remains unchanged, so the density may decrease slightly. The change in air pressure, although the impact is relatively small, cannot be ignored in the very precise determination.
